The Ama-gi cuneiform is a significant symbol for lovers of liberty. It is believed to be the first written expression of freedom, with multiple translations including "freedom," "manumission," and "exemption from debts or obligations."  The earliest known usage of the word was in the decree of Enmetena restoring "the child to his mother and the mother to her child." By the Third Dynasty of Ur, it was used as a legal term for the manumission of individuals.
